What Is Solventless Lamination?

Lamination is the process of bonding two or more flexible materials—such as plastic films, paper, or aluminum foil—to create a multilayer structure with enhanced properties. Each layer contributes something unique, from strength and barrier protection to printability and appearance.

In a solventless lamination process, the adhesive used to bond the layers contains no solvents or volatile organic compounds (VOCs). This means no drying ovens are required, resulting in lower energy consumption and a more sustainable operation overall.


How the Solventless Lamination Process Works

The lamination machine is designed to bring together two webs (or rolls) of material, typically known as web A and web B, to form a single laminated web. Here’s a breakdown of the steps:

  1. Unwinding the Webs:
  2. Two large reels of material are mounted on unwinders A and B. These webs are drawn into the laminator.
  3. Adhesive Application:
  4. A thin layer of solventless adhesive—often polyurethane-based—is applied to one side of the web coming from coil A. The adhesive has 100% solid content, meaning it contains no solvent to evaporate.
  5. Lamination (Nipping):
  6. The two webs pass between two tangential rollers, which apply pressure to bond them together evenly.
  7. Rewinding the Laminated Web:
  8. The finished laminate is rewound onto a new roll using a rewinder, ready for curing or downstream processing.

Because no drying is required, the oven section of the laminator remains off, significantly reducing both energy use and carbon emissions.


Switching to solventless technology brings multiple environmental, operational, and economic advantages:


🌿 1. Environmentally Friendly

No solvents mean zero VOC emissions and no hazardous waste. This helps companies meet stricter environmental standards and supports corporate sustainability goals.

2. Energy and Cost Efficiency

Without the need for a drying oven, energy consumption drops dramatically. This reduces operating costs and maintenance requirements, improving profitability.

🍽️ 3. Food-Safe Packaging

Since the process leaves no solvent residues, the laminated material is ideal for food and pharmaceutical packaging applications where purity and safety are critical.

🏭 4. Cleaner, Safer Work Environment

Removing solvents also removes fire and explosion risks, creating a safer production environment for plant operators.

💪 5. High-Performance Bonds

Modern solventless adhesives deliver excellent adhesion, clarity, and durability—ensuring the laminate performs reliably under a wide range of conditions.
